lesavka/scripts/manual/audio-clip-fetch.sh

15 lines
424 B
Bash
Raw Normal View History

2025-06-30 14:20:07 -05:00
#!/usr/bin/env bash
# scripts/manual/audio-clip-fetch.sh
# Pull & play the most recent 1 s AAC clip from lesavkaserver
PI_HOST="nikto@192.168.42.253" # adjust
REMOTE_DIR="/tmp"
2025-07-01 10:23:51 -05:00
DEST="$(mktemp -u).wav"
2025-06-30 14:20:07 -05:00
scp "${PI_HOST}:${REMOTE_DIR}/ear-*.aac" "$DEST" 2>/dev/null \
|| { echo "❌ no clip files yet"; exit 1; }
LATEST=$(ls -1t ear-*.aac | head -n1)
echo "🎧 playing ${LATEST} ..."
gst-play-1.0 --quiet "${LATEST}"